RTGI, which stands for Ray-Traced Global Illumination , is a post-processing technology that simulates how light bounces naturally off surfaces, creating incredibly lifelike visuals in real time. The most famous RTGI shader was created by developer Pascal Gilcher (McFly).While early beta versions were locked behind a Patreon subscription, older stable builds and alternative open-source ray tracing shaders are widely available for free. 1. Pascal Gilcher’s RTGI (Legacy Free Versions)

Once ReShade is installed, you will need to drop your downloaded RTGI .fx files into the reshade-shaders/Shaders folder within your game directory.

Simulates actual light rays as they bounce from one object to another. If you stand next to a red wall, the light hitting your character’s shoulder will have a subtle red tint.
